Anthony “Essy” Curatolo, born in Rosebank in 1940, was a three-sport athlete at New Dorp High School. After playing minor league baseball, he married Mary Ann Cloke and had eight children in 10 years. He worked as a letter carrier for the USPS and coached basketball and softball at various schools, including winning the New York State Federation Championship in 1993 with St. Joseph Hill Academy.
